10K reactions · 594 shares | Dr. Michael Burry did what no one else on Wall Street dared to do. While the world celebrated endless growth and ignored the warning signs, he saw cracks in the system and ran the numbers that everyone else overlooked. Betting billions against the housing market, he faced ridicule, skepticism, and pressure from investors who thought he was crazy.
When the financial collapse hit in 2008, Burry didn’t just survive—he profited massively from the chaos.
